HomeMy WebLinkAbout1931-04-03 Regular MinutesTukwila, April 2, 1931.
The regular meeting of the Town Council <af the Town of Tukwidta
was held in the Town Hall on the above date at 8 :00 P.M. Those
present were Mayor John R. Walkup and Councilmen Philip Koenig, J.
C. Wickman and J. R. Cumming.
The minutes of the last r_egtiax meeting were read by the
Clerk and approved.

After a brief recess called by the Mayor for the auditing
of the bills the Council was called to order to hear the report of
tbe Finance Committee. The chairman of the finance committee reported
all the bills hadnbiaa= appooved as presented. A motion that all
bills be allowed as recomended by the finance committee and warrants
be drawn for their respective amounts was made seconded and carried
A motion that the office of deptty;•Steasurer for tbe purpose of
collecting water bills be discontinued Iil,30i331.was made ,seconded
and on roll call carried. with Councilmen Koenig, Yes. ,Wickman
Tee. and Cumming Tes.
COMMUNICATIONS
The Treasurer's monthly financial report was read by the
clerk and ordered filed. Tie report of the Water Supt. was read.
The clerk reported a telephone message from Mr. Crawford of the
Puget Sound power and Light Co. stating that the Town might cut
and burn an# brush along the right of way they wiphed to.
The contract for grftg; and increased minimun of water for
a period of three years, from the Seattle Water Dept. was read
by the clerk. A motion was made seconded and carried that the
Mayor and Clerk be instructed to sign the contract with the City
of Seattle Water Dept., for the Town of Tukwila.
OLD BUSINESS
Aft some discussion regarding the side walks on Main St.
a, motion was made seconded and carried that the Street Committee
and the clerk make a survey of the side walks and notify the
proper; 'bw !eri to kepttir Or *place the old walks as needed.

I.motioarwasr trade ,seconded and carried that the water bill of
Mr. Nager be corrected to relieve him of the excess water charge
against his meter caused by a break for which he was'not reef
ponsible. TVmotion was malts seconded and carried instructing the
water Supt. to correct the water bill of M. Ives charging him
with 50 of the overage, charged against his meter. Iesolttton
48v.ttseetiedgdfdiel Tres.suieer to correct the L.I.D. #1 assessment
roll was read by the clerk.A motion was mate and seconded and on
roll call passed adopting resolution #48. Those Voting were
Councilmen Koenig. Yes. Wickman Yes Cumming, Yes.
No other business appearing. It was moved seconded and carried
that the council adjourn. Time 9.45 P. M,
